  • Greek Theatre Scholar
    • Hall-Purpose Of Tragedy: 'the plot should be constructed that even anyone hearing of the incidents happening thrills with fear and pity as a result of what occurs'
    • Knox-Tragic hero: 'A tragic hero is someone whose downfall is routed in their personal nature (physis), which they stay true to until the point of destruction'
    • Rutherford-Fate: 'The character's failures indicate their moral, the inability of human beings to understand the divine plan'
    • Hall-context: 'The greek mind was trained to think in polarities; to categorise, distinguish and oppose.
